
Mumbai, August 8: Chitra Wagh, a leader of the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P), has expressed strong support for Prime Minister Narendra Modi, emphasizing the role of Gen Z in shaping India’s future. During an interview, Wagh discussed various topics including self-reliant India, drone technology, and Congress leader Rahul Gandhi’s ‘Students’ Echo’ campaign.
Wagh stated that today’s youth is the future of India. She praised PM Modi’s continuous efforts to improve the nation. Addressing the issue of paper leaks, she noted that such incidents have occurred in every government. However, she highlighted that PM Modi has demonstrated his commitment through stringent measures to protect the future of children.
On the topic of self-reliant India, Wagh expressed pride in the country’s economic progress, moving from the 11th to the 4th position globally. She believes that under PM Modi’s leadership, India is advancing in all sectors.
Wagh also mentioned the remarkable progress in Maharashtra, where women in rural areas are now operating drones. This initiative has contributed significantly to the economy, with drones being used for medical deliveries, showcasing the effective use of drone technology under PM Modi’s guidance.
Responding to Rahul Gandhi’s ‘Students’ Echo’ campaign, Wagh remarked that Gen Z is aware of their true allies. She criticized certain political parties for attempting to exploit the youth movement, asserting that the youth of India stand united with PM Modi.
Furthermore, Wagh supported PM Modi’s concerns about disruptions in Parliament, emphasizing that he is a dedicated public servant working tirelessly for the nation. She stressed the importance of representatives discussing public issues in the House, while expressing concern over opposition parties obstructing parliamentary proceedings.
